Introduction
Collaboration between designers and developers in UI/UX design is a critical element for enhancing user experience. Effective collaboration directly impacts the success of a project. Adopting a user-centered approach requires the integration of these two disciplines to understand user needs and produce solutions that meet those needs.The Importance of UI/UX Design
UI/UX design is one of the most crucial elements that determine a product's interaction with its users. User experience and interface design affect the product's usability, accessibility, and overall satisfaction level. By 2026, investments in user experience design are expected to increase by 50%. This clearly demonstrates the significance of UI/UX design in the business world.
The Necessity of Collaboration Between Designers and Developers
Designers and developers interact at various stages of projects to ensure that the resulting product is successful both aesthetically and functionally. This collaboration is of great importance as it allows for user feedback to be processed more quickly and effectively.
Methods of Designer and Developer Collaboration
Agile Methods
Agile methods facilitate continuous communication between designer and developer teams and enable quick feedback. Implementing these methods increases project flexibility and equips teams to respond swiftly to changing user needs. The table below illustrates the impact of Agile methods on designer and developer collaboration:
| Method | Description | Advantages |
|---|---|---|
| Scrum | Identification of tasks to be completed in a short time | Enhances communication within the team |
| Kanban | Visualization of processes and management of flow | Balances the workload |
| Scrumban | A combination of Scrum and Kanban | Enables rapid adaptation |
Visual Prototyping and Wireframe Usage
Using visual prototyping and wireframes makes it easier for designers to share their ideas with developers. These methods provide an opportunity to test user experience in the early stages of design and help identify potential issues beforehand.
javascript
// Example wireframe structure
const wireframe = {
header: "Application Title",
mainContent: "Main Content Area",
footer: "Contact Information"
};
Regular Feedback and Interactive Work
Receiving regular feedback and engaging in interactive work keeps the design process dynamic. Designers and developers can continuously communicate through user tests and prototypes to optimize user experience.
Real Example: Experience of Company X
Project Description
Company X, a startup operating in the e-commerce sector, decided to develop a new mobile application. At the beginning of the project, there was insufficient communication between the designer and developer teams.
Collaboration Process and Results
In the later stages of the project, the designer and developer teams adopted Agile methods to initiate a more effective collaboration process. Following this transition, user feedback began to be evaluated rapidly, resulting in a 40% improvement in the application's user experience. After the application launch, user satisfaction surveys received an 85% positive response rate.
Common Mistakes
Lack of Communication and Misunderstanding
Lack of communication between designers and developers can lead to project failures. Misunderstandings about the functionality of the design can negatively impact user experience.
Insufficient Testing Processes During the Prototyping Phase
The absence of adequate testing processes during the prototyping phase can result in a low-quality final product. A process that does not gather user feedback increases the risk of overlooking design errors.
A Point Most Teams Miss: The Importance of User Feedback
Surveys vs. Observations
In addition to surveys, observations are critical for collecting user feedback. While surveys help understand user needs, observations can provide deeper insights. You can check this source.
The Role of Qualitative Data in User Experience
Qualitative data plays an important role in understanding user experience. Analyzing user behavior helps make the design more effective.
Brief Summary for Sharing
- Continuous communication between designers and developers is essential.
- Prototypes need to be supported by user testing.
- Adopting Agile methods strengthens collaboration.
Conclusion
Collaboration between designers and developers in UI/UX design is a critical factor that directly affects user experience. Optimizing this collaboration enhances project success. It is possible to improve the design process by considering user feedback and using effective methods.
If you want to make your projects more effective and provide a quality user experience, contact us: get in touch.



